Really not impressed with the number of Saturday afternoon games we are losing . It’s not like we are a bloody big club ! For me the Saturday routine with the pub beforehand etc.... is what it’s all about. It’s just got a weird feel to it this season so far to me...
Saturday 24th August: Home to Luton Saturday 31st August: Away to Wigan Saturday 7th September: International break Saturday 14th September: No game Saturday 21st September: Away to Forest Saturday 28th September: No game Saturday 5th October: Away to PNE Saturday 12th October: International break Saturday 19th October Home to Swansea Saturday 26th October Away to Huddersfield Saturday 2nd November: No game Saturday 9th November: Stoke at home Saturday 16th November: International break Saturday 23rd November: Away at Blackburn. So that will be TWO that's TWO home Saturday games in 14 weeks. Three and a half months with two fixtures at home at the time we want games at. It will affect crowds especially if we don't pick up points soon as folks will not pay our POTD prices to freeze whilst we lose in cold weather.
